Walnut Creek is a village located in Greene County, North Carolina. Walnut Creek has a 2025 population of 1,108 . Walnut Creek is currently growing at a rate of 0.45% annually and its population has increased by 2.5%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 1,081 in 2020.
The average household income in Walnut Creek is $223,423 with a poverty rate of 8.14%. The median age in Walnut Creek is 42.4 years: 37.2 years for males, and 50.7 years for females. For every 100 females there are 135.9 males.

Walnut Creek's average per capita income is $82,543. Household income levels show a median of $145,417. The poverty rate stands at 8.14%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$193,047 | - |
| Families | $151,944 | $232,263 |
| Households | $145,417 | $223,423 |
| Non Families | $100,313 | $120,865 |
